Located in the heart of Surrey, Kempton Park Train Station is your gateway to a myriad of destinations within the UK. Whether you're a regular commuter or an occasional traveler planning an excursion to the races at the nearby Kempton Park Racecourse, the station offers a variety of services and connections to suit your travel needs. Although it's a small station, it provides essential amenities to ensure smooth travel.
While Kempton Park might surprise you with its quaintness, it doesn't fall short of basic facilities. You won't find a ticket office here, but there are ticket machines available for purchasing and collecting tickets. This is perfect for those who prefer the flexibility of buying tickets online. Accessibility is a key factor at Kempton Park, with ticket machines supporting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. Should you need assistance, use the help points located within the station, where staff are happy to assist via help lines. Keep in mind there are no waiting rooms, toilets, or refreshment facilities, so it's best to plan ahead if you need any of these services.
Traveling beyond Kempton Park Station is a breeze with various transport links. The station provides clear information for bus routes, including maps for planning your onward journey. If rail service faces any disruptions, rail replacement services run toward Shepperton and Fulwell from Staines Road East. Nestled in the heart of Scotland, Holytown Train Station serves as a quaint yet significant point of transit for both locals and travelers exploring this scenic region. Whether you're commuting for work, catching a train for a day trip, or embarking on a holiday, Holytown station provides an essential gateway to a variety of destinations. Despite its modest size, it offers some key facilities and connections that cater to the needs of rail passengers.
Holytown Train Station is equipped with automatic ticket machines, making it easy to purchase or collect tickets bought online thanks to their accessibility throughout the station. For those relying on smartcards, validators are conveniently available, although the station doesn’t issue smartcards themselves. While there isn't a ticket office or large shopping facilities, the essentials are taken care of with customer help points available for traveler inquiries.
When it comes to accessibility, the station offers step-free access to some parts, specifically level access to platform 2 and a ramp to platform 1. However, be cautious as stepping distances can vary at certain parts of platform 2. Unfortunately, the station does not have waiting rooms or accessible toilets, but seating areas and helpful induction loops are provided for added comfort.
Holytown Train Station provides several connections to ensure smooth onward travel. For those occasions when rail replacement services are necessary, Holytown offers buses from Quarry Street next to the phone box on the Platform 2 side. More information on bus services can be obtained from Traveline Scotland. Meanwhile, taxi services can also be arranged via TrainTaxi for convenient travel solutions beyond the station.
